Hydrasynth Deluxe 73 Key Synthesizer Sonic Lab Review


video upload by sonicstate

"We take a look at the new Ashun Sound Machines Hydrasynth Deluxe. The new model, announced just before Superbooth 21, doubles the voice count - either 16 voices in single sound mode or two complete 8 voice Hydrasynth Engines for split or layer. Each layer has a dedicated stereo audio output pair, and the Polytouch polyphonic after touch keybed gets enlarged to 73 keys.
Its a whopper.
Available priced at 1499 UK and $1799

Introducing the Emthree PFV3


video upload by Vintage Audio Institute Italia

This appears to be the first demo of one on the site. One went up for sale back in 2016.

"Amazingly rare, battery run formant filter, or rather EQ, machine produced in Italy by Emthree, formerly Meazzi, probably in the early 1980s.
It has two modes:
1. Full on engage of three filters / EQ settings / Vowels by pressing the buttons.
2. Gradual engage by using the three potentiometers.

The two modes cannot be engaged simultaneously.

Kawai K5000R Additive Synth Module

"In its day, the K5000 was Kawai’s flagship synth. 1997 saw the rack version released which features digital additive synthesis plus PCM samples, arpeggiator and onboard effects. It can be programmed much like a standard VCO subtractive synth or just use the PCM samples, however, it gets very interesting when delving in to the world of additive synthesis. Look at some of the youtube videos for examples.

Additional Features:
Memory upgraded - this doubles the preset storage available with additional banks "E" and "F". On the K5000, preset size is a movable beast; the more complex the preset, the more storage memory is required to save it. The memory upgrade allows storage of many more presets.

Latest OS 4.04 loaded."

LED Matrix sync with DIY modular Synthesizer - [YMNK's DIY synths adventures]


video upload by YMNK

"This is a really small demo about something I've been working on the past few weeks.
This is 16*64 programmable LED matrix that can be synced by CV Gate or by MIDI.

The entire display contains 2x 16*32 LED matrix from Adafruit ( https://www.adafruit.com/product/420 ), 2 Arduino Unos and some electronic to make all this mess understanding CV gate or MIDI messages.

The images/animations have been hardcoded by myself on the arduinos (the code is here : https://github.com/alexiszbik/liveled... ... but I still have to add the schematics ...) ... and it is really difficult to fit a lot of animations in such a tiny memory. But it is a nice challenge!

I use the display for my third official gig as YMNK in Roubaix, France at La Condition Publique. Everything worked perfectly so, I'm very happy about it! Still I want to make more animation now! I've some videos, I should probably upload them in the next few days!"
